A. Hartke et al., STARVATION-INDUCED STRESS RESISTANCE IN LACTOCOCCUS-LACTIS SUBSP LACTIS IL1403, Applied and environmental microbiology, 60(9), 1994, pp. 3474-3478
Carbohydrate-starved cultures of Lactococcus lactis subsp. lactis IL14
03 showed enhanced resistance to heat, ethanol, acid, osmotic, and oxi
dative stresses. This cross-protection seems to be established progres
sively during the transitional growth phase, with maximum resistance o
ccurring when cells enter the stationary phase. Chloramphenicol or rif
amycin treatment does not abolish the development of a tolerant cell s
tate but, on the contrary, seems to provoke this response in L. lactis
subsp. lactis.
